区块链的底层技术,只做区块链底层技术的公司
1、区块链的底层技术
区块链作为一种新兴的分布式账本技术,近年来备受关注。它的底层技术是支撑整个系统运行的核心,对于了解和应用区块链至关重要。本站将介绍区块链的底层技术,助力读者更好地理解这一领域。
区块链的底层技术之一是哈希算法。哈希算法是将任意长度的数据转换为固定长度的字符串的算法,常用的有SHA-256和MD5等。在区块链中,哈希算法被广泛应用于数据的完整性验证和区块的链接。通过对数据进行哈希运算,可以生成唯一的哈希值,任何对数据进行修改都会导致哈希值的改变,从而保证了数据的完整性。
区块链的底层技术还包括共识算法。共识算法是指在分布式环境下,节点之间如何达成一致的规则和机制。常见的共识算法有工作量证明(Proof of Work)和权益证明(Proof of Stake)等。工作量证明是通过节点完成一定的计算任务来获得记账权的机制,而权益证明则是根据节点持有的货币数量来确定记账权。共识算法的选择直接影响到区块链的性能、安全性和去中心化程度。
区块链的底层技术还包括分布式网络和点对点通信。区块链是一个由多个节点组成的分布式网络,节点之间通过点对点通信进行数据的传输和交换。分布式网络的设计和实现需要考虑节点之间的连接方式、数据传输的安全性和可靠性等因素。点对点通信则保证了数据的直接传输,避免了中心化服务器的单点故障和数据篡改的风险。
区块链的底层技术还涉及智能合约和去中心化存储等方面。智能合约是一种在区块链上执行的可编程合约,它可以实现自动化的交易和业务逻辑。智能合约的编写和执行需要使用特定的编程语言和虚拟机。去中心化存储则是将数据分散存储在多个节点上,提高数据的可靠性和安全性。
区块链的底层技术包括哈希算法、共识算法、分布式网络和点对点通信、智能合约以及去中心化存储等方面。这些技术相互配合,构成了区块链系统的基础架构。了解和掌握区块链的底层技术对于理解其原理和应用具有重要意义,也有助于推动区块链技术的进一步发展和创新。
2、只做区块链底层技术的公司
科技的不断进步和发展,区块链技术正逐渐进入人们的视野。作为一种分布式账本技术,区块链具有去中心化、透明、安全等特点,被广泛应用于金融、供应链管理、物联网等领域。在这个快速发展的行业中,有一类公司专注于区块链底层技术的研发和应用,它们以“只做区块链底层技术的公司”为主题,为行业的发展做出了重要贡献。
区块链底层技术的公司,其主要任务是研发和维护区块链的核心技术。区块链技术的核心包括共识算法、加密算法、分布式存储等,这些技术的稳定性和安全性对整个区块链系统的运行至关重要。这类公司通常拥有一支由区块链领域专家组成的研发团队,他们致力于不断提升底层技术的性能和安全性,为区块链应用提供坚实的基础。
这类公司的核心竞争力在于技术创新和研发实力。他们不仅要紧跟区块链技术的最新发展,还要不断推陈出新,提出新的解决方案和算法。例如,一些公司在共识算法方面进行了深入研究,提出了更高效、更安全的共识算法,为区块链的扩展性和性能提供了更好的支持。一些公司还在隐私保护、智能合约等方面进行了研究,为区块链应用的发展带来了新的可能性。
除了技术创新,区块链底层技术的公司还需要与其他企业和机构进行紧密合作。他们可以与金融机构合作,为其提供安全可靠的区块链解决方案,提升金融交易的效率和安全性。他们还可以与供应链管理公司合作,利用区块链技术提供可追溯的供应链管理解决方案,确保产品的质量和安全。与机构的合作也是重要的一部分,区块链技术可以为提供更高效、透明的公共服务,提升治理的能力。
在未来,区块链技术的进一步发展和应用,区块链底层技术的公司将发挥更加重要的作用。他们将继续致力于技术创新,推动区块链技术的发展。他们还需要与其他行业的企业和机构进行深度合作,共同推动区块链技术的应用,实现区块链技术在各行各业的广泛应用。
“只做区块链底层技术的公司”以其技术创新和研发实力,为区块链技术的发展做出了重要贡献。他们的努力将为区块链技术的应用提供坚实的基础,推动区块链技术在各个领域的广泛应用,为社会的发展带来新的机遇和挑战。
3、数字货币有哪些底层技术
数字货币是指以数字形式存在的货币,它们在现实世界中没有实体形态,但在网络世界中具有交易和流通的功能。数字货币的兴起离不开底层技术的支持,下面将介绍数字货币的几种常见底层技术。
首先是区块链技术。区块链是一种分布式数据库技术,它将交易记录以区块的形式链接在一起,形成一个不可篡改的链条。区块链的特点是去中心化、透明和安全。在数字货币中,区块链被用作交易记录的公共账本,确保交易的可追溯性和安全性。
其次是加密算法技术。数字货币使用加密算法对交易进行加密和验证。加密算法保证了交易的安全性和隐私性。常见的加密算法包括哈希算法和非对称加密算法。哈希算法可以将任意长度的数据转化为固定长度的字符串,通过对比哈希值来验证数据的完整性。非对称加密算法使用公钥和私钥对数据进行加密和解密,保证了交易的机密性。
再次是共识算法技术。共识算法用于解决分布式系统中的一致性问题,确保网络中的节点对交易记录的一致性达成共识。常见的共识算法包括工作量证明(PoW)、权益证明(PoS)和权威证明(PoA)。工作量证明是通过解决复杂的数学难题来获得记账权,权益证明是根据持有的货币数量来决定记账权,权威证明是由特定的节点来验证和记账。
最后是智能合约技术。智能合约是一种自动执行合约条款的计算机程序,它可以在没有第三方介入的情况下,根据预先设定的规则和条件执行交易。智能合约可以实现去中心化的交易和自动化的执行,提高交易的效率和可信度。以太坊是最早引入智能合约的数字货币平台。
数字货币的底层技术包括区块链、加密算法、共识算法和智能合约。这些技术相互配合,确保了数字货币的安全、可靠和高效。技术的不断发展和创新,数字货币的底层技术也在不断演进,为数字经济的发展提供了新的可能性。
4、区块链在医疗领域的应用
区块链技术作为一种去中心化、安全可信的分布式账本技术,近年来在各个领域得到了广泛应用。医疗领域作为一个信息密集、数据敏感的行业,也开始逐渐探索并应用区块链技术,以提升医疗数据的安全性、隐私保护和信息共享效率。
区块链技术可以改善医疗数据的安全性和可信度。传统的医疗数据存储方式容易受到黑客攻击和数据篡改的风险,而区块链技术的去中心化和加密特性能够有效地防止数据被篡改和窃取。每一笔医疗数据都会以区块的形式被记录下来,并通过密码学算法进行加密,确保数据的完整性和安全性。由于区块链上的数据是分布式存储的,即使某个节点遭到攻击或故障,其他节点仍然能够保持数据的完整性和可访问性。
区块链技术可以提供更好的医疗数据隐私保护。在传统的医疗数据交换中,患者的个人隐私往往难以得到有效保护。而区块链技术通过身份验证和加密技术,可以确保患者个人隐私的安全。患者可以通过授权,选择性地共享自己的医疗数据给特定的医疗机构或研究机构,而不必担心数据被滥用或泄露。区块链的透明性和可追溯性也可以助力监管机构对医疗数据的使用情况进行监督,保护患者的权益。
区块链技术还可以提高医疗信息的共享效率和互操作性。在传统的医疗系统中,不同医疗机构之间的数据交换往往困难重重,导致信息孤岛和数据割裂的问题。而区块链技术可以建立一个共享的医疗数据网络,使得不同机构之间可以安全、高效地共享和访问医疗数据。这有助于提高医疗决策的准确性和效率,避免重复检查和治疗,提升医疗资源的利用效率。
区块链技术还可以推动医疗领域的创新和发展。通过区块链技术,可以建立智能合约和去中心化应用,实现医疗数据的自动化管理和智能化分析。例如,利用区块链技术可以建立医疗数据市场,激励患者主动共享自己的医疗数据,促进医疗研究和医学进步。区块链技术还可以应用于药品溯源、医疗保险、临床试验等方面,推动医疗行业的数字化转型和创新发展。
区块链技术在医疗领域具有广阔的应用前景。通过提升医疗数据的安全性、隐私保护和信息共享效率,区块链可以为医疗行业带来更加安全、高效和可信的数据管理和交换方式,推动医疗领域的数字化转型和创新发展。
3D知识网 - 分享有价值知识版权声明:以上内容作者已申请原创保护,未经允许不得转载,侵权必究!授权事宜、对本内容有异议或投诉,敬请联系网站管理员,我们将尽快回复您,谢谢合作!